
Hr2 - Brian Jones: Indiana is a Legitimate Big Ten Contender
About this episode
In the 2nd hour of today's show, Dukes and Bell analyze the Atlanta Falcons' roster cuts and the ongoing discussion regarding Michael Penix Jr.'s health. CBS college football analyst analyst Brian Jones joins to evaluate the current state of college football and a groundbreaking CTE treatment study being conducted at Emory University. They also touch on international soccer news and Angel Reese's WNBA record.
